    I went ahead and made this it's own thread.

    PF is a smaller site, mostly by design, and you have to be a paid site supporter to list things for sale. Because of that we have a much lower "trade volume" then big sites and you're more likely to be dealing with a known person vs a stranger. As such, a trader feedback system is probably overkill, even if the software here would support it. Which I don't know if it will or not.

    Doesn’t really work unless everybody does it.

    On another (non-gun) forum I was on, they had a B/S/T Karma count, but I only got tagged for about 1/3 of my deals. That was a common complaint, that nobody used it as intended.

    It was still all 100% positive, but only showed a fraction of my dealings.
